WebIf you drink (say) 300 mL of cold water, ie, at ~10 C or so, it will take a few minutes at most for it to reach thermal equilibrium with your body temperature (~37 C). This is well-understood physics. It makes no difference if you drink cold (~10 C) or warm (~25 C) water - it will pass from your stomach into the rest of your body at essentially ... WebMar 9, 2024 · Martin Riese, the preeminent water sommelier, agrees that water is best served at room temperature. Cold water numbs your taste buds, he explained in an August 2024 video, which dulls the experience. WebNov 28, 2016 · The intensity of taste is greatest for water at room temperature and is significantly reduced by chilling or heating the water. WebJan 26, 2016 · Why Is Room Temperature Important? When at room temperature, eggs, butter, and other dairy ingredients form an emulsion which traps air. While baking in the oven, that trapped air expands and produces a fluffy baked good.
